Who It's For
The Boxing Reflex Ball is a good match for families, casual fitness users and beginners who want to practice timing, speed and hand eye coordination without a big time or space commitment. It works particularly well for parents who want a playful training activity to do with children, and for solo users looking to sharpen reflexes between workouts.
It is not a substitute for heavy bag work or sparring for advanced boxers who require resistance training and realistic punch impact. Serious fighters seeking power conditioning or precise sparring preparation should pair this set with other equipment or look elsewhere for heavy-contact training tools.
